1. Immersive Farewell Scenery: The scenic area evokes the atmosphere of Wang Wei's famous line, "I urge you to drink another cup of wine, for beyond Yangguan there will be no old friends." Yangguan was a pass on the southern route of the ancient Silk Road, symbolizing parting and long journeys. The area features a statue of Wang Wei and a large rock beach inscribed with frontier poems, creating a strong atmosphere suitable for reflection and contemplation. 2. Comprehensive Facilities and Diverse Experiences: The area includes the Yangguan Museum, with exhibits explaining the history of the Silk Road and the two passes, eliminating the need for rote memorization of historical materials. There's also a replica of a Han Dynasty military headquarters where visitors can experience the process of obtaining official travel documents (关照), simulating the formalities of leaving the pass, creating a strong sense of ceremony. Additionally, there are replicas of ancient military camps and educational activities, making it more accessible to general tourists and families. 3. Authentic Remains Preserved: The true cultural relics are the Yangguan beacon towers (烽火台), the "eyes and ears" of Yangguan. At your feet lies the Antique Beach, where numerous Han Dynasty artifacts have been unearthed throughout history. A sightseeing bus takes you directly to the ruins, and you can walk along the Yangguan Avenue wooden boardwalk to experience the farewell atmosphere of the Gobi Desert up close. 4. Relaxed Tour Pace: The scenic area is well-planned with a clear tour route, and the entire tour can be completed in about 2 hours. Compared to Yumenguan, there are more man-made facilities, so it's not just bare mounds of earth, making it easier for novice tourists to understand and participate.
